Extracellular Matrix
A network of proteins or carbohydrates that provide structural support to cells.
Tight Junctions
Connections between adjacent animal cells that form regulated barriers and watertight seals.
Desmosomes
Strong connections that hold animal cells together to form tissues through proteins called cadherins.
Gap Junctions
Narrow protein channels made of connexin that allow for communication between adjacent animal cells.
Collagen
A protein that forms a strong but flexible matrix in the extracellular matrix of animal cells.
Proteoglycan
Proteins that form a gelatinous matrix in the extracellular matrix, binding water and resisting compression.
Plasmodesmata
Small cylindrical extensions of the plasma membrane in plant cells that allow for communication between neighboring cells.
Cellulose Microfibrils
Carbohydrates that form a strong, rigid matrix in the cell wall of plant cells.
Turgor Pressure
The pressure within a plant cell that keeps it firm, counteracted by the cell wall.
Pectin
A carbohydrate that forms a gelatinous matrix in plant cells, helping to bind water and resist compression.
